What business problem should the adoption strategy solve first?
Enterprise leaders often begin with a technology question, but the more useful starting point is economic friction. Where are delays, leakage, rework, or control failures occurring between order capture, vendor spend, and financial reporting? In practice, the first phase should identify the highest-value process chain to unify. For a SaaS-oriented business, that is often quote-to-bill and procure-to-pay, because both directly affect cash flow, margin visibility, and audit readiness.
Discovery and assessment should map current systems, approval paths, data ownership, reporting dependencies, and compliance obligations. Business process analysis then clarifies where standard Odoo capabilities fit and where process redesign is preferable to customization. Gap analysis should distinguish between true business-critical gaps and legacy habits that no longer deserve system support. This discipline prevents expensive overengineering and keeps the implementation aligned with measurable business outcomes.
| Assessment Area | Key Questions | Implementation Impact |
|---|---|---|
| Billing model | Are revenues one-time, recurring, usage-based, milestone-based, or mixed? | Determines use of Accounting, Subscription, invoicing rules, revenue recognition approach, and integration scope |
| Procurement controls | How are requests, approvals, vendor onboarding, and receipt validation managed today? | Shapes Purchase workflows, approval design, vendor master governance, and segregation of duties |
| Reporting model | Which reports are operational, managerial, statutory, and board-level? | Defines chart of accounts structure, analytic dimensions, consolidation logic, and dashboard priorities |
| Operating structure | Is the business multi-company, multi-currency, or multi-warehouse? | Influences architecture, security model, intercompany design, and rollout sequencing |
| Integration landscape | Which external systems must remain in place? | Drives API-first architecture, middleware decisions, and data ownership boundaries |
How should Odoo be architected for integrated billing, procurement, and reporting?
The solution architecture should be designed around a single source of transactional truth with controlled system boundaries. In Odoo, billing and procurement should feed the accounting layer through governed workflows rather than through offline adjustments. Reporting should consume standardized financial and operational data structures, not manually reconciled extracts. This is where enterprise architecture matters: the ERP should own core commercial, purchasing, and accounting events, while adjacent platforms retain specialized functions only when they provide clear business value.
Functional design should define billing scenarios, procurement policies, approval matrices, vendor lifecycle rules, tax handling, analytic accounting, and reporting dimensions. Technical design should then address API patterns, identity and access management, auditability, document retention, and cloud deployment. For organizations with multiple legal entities, a multi-company implementation should standardize shared policies while allowing local tax, currency, and reporting variations. Multi-warehouse design becomes relevant when procurement and inventory receipts affect cost recognition, stock valuation, or service delivery dependencies.
- Use Odoo Accounting as the financial control layer when billing and procurement events must reconcile directly to management and statutory reporting.
- Use Purchase to formalize requisition, approval, purchase order, receipt, and vendor bill matching where spend governance is weak or decentralized.
- Use Subscription when recurring billing, renewals, and contract-linked invoicing are central to the revenue model.
- Use Documents and Knowledge when procurement evidence, policies, and billing support artifacts need governed access and traceability.
- Use Spreadsheet and reporting views when executives need live operational and financial analysis without spreadsheet-based data assembly.
What implementation methodology reduces risk without slowing value delivery?
A phased enterprise methodology is usually more effective than a big-bang rollout. The recommended sequence is foundation first, then process integration, then optimization. Foundation includes chart of accounts design, company structure, tax model, approval policies, security roles, and core master data. Process integration then connects billing, procurement, and reporting workflows end to end. Optimization follows after go-live, when real transaction patterns reveal where automation, analytics, and policy refinement will produce the next wave of value.
Configuration strategy should prioritize standard Odoo capabilities before any custom development. Customization strategy should be reserved for differentiated business rules, regulatory requirements, or integration needs that cannot be addressed through configuration, Studio, or proven community extensions. OCA module evaluation can be appropriate where mature modules address practical gaps, but each candidate should be reviewed for maintainability, version compatibility, security posture, and long-term support implications. Enterprise teams should avoid adopting community modules simply because they are available; they should be selected only when they reduce implementation risk or accelerate a validated requirement.
Recommended delivery stages
| Stage | Primary Objective | Executive Decision Gate |
|---|---|---|
| Discovery and assessment | Confirm business case, scope, process pain points, and target operating model | Approve scope boundaries and success metrics |
| Design | Complete gap analysis, solution architecture, functional design, and technical design | Approve blueprint and customization policy |
| Build and configure | Configure applications, integrations, security, reports, and migration assets | Approve readiness for integrated testing |
| Validate | Run UAT, performance testing, security testing, and cutover rehearsals | Approve go-live based on evidence, not optimism |
| Deploy and stabilize | Execute go-live, hypercare support, and issue triage | Approve transition to continuous improvement |
How should integration, data migration, and governance be handled?
An API-first architecture is essential when billing, procurement, and reporting touch external CRM, payment, banking, tax, procurement marketplace, or business intelligence platforms. The design principle should be clear system ownership: define where customer, vendor, contract, product, invoice, payment, and reporting data are mastered, then integrate accordingly. This reduces duplicate logic and prevents reconciliation disputes. Enterprise integration should also include error handling, retry logic, monitoring, and observability so operational teams can detect failures before they affect month-end close or supplier payments.
Data migration strategy should focus on business continuity rather than historical perfection. Not every legacy record belongs in the new ERP. Migrate the data needed to operate, report, and audit with confidence: active customers, vendors, open receivables, open payables, active contracts, product and service catalogs, tax mappings, chart of accounts, analytic structures, and selected historical balances. Master data governance should define ownership, approval rules, naming standards, deduplication controls, and stewardship responsibilities across finance, procurement, and operations.
For cloud deployment strategy, SaaS ERP leaders should evaluate resilience, security operations, and scalability alongside cost. Where managed hosting is required, components such as PostgreSQL, Redis, containerized services with Docker, orchestration patterns such as Kubernetes where operationally justified, and centralized monitoring can support enterprise scalability and controlled releases. What testing, training, and change management determine adoption success?
User Acceptance Testing should be scenario-based, not screen-based. Test complete business outcomes such as recurring invoice generation, purchase approval escalation, three-way matching, intercompany billing, month-end accrual review, and executive dashboard validation. Performance testing is especially important when reporting loads, invoice runs, or approval workflows peak at period close. Security testing should validate role segregation, approval authority, audit trails, document access, and identity and access management controls across companies and departments.
Training strategy should be role-specific and tied to decisions users must make, not just transactions they must enter. Procurement approvers need policy context. Finance teams need exception handling and reconciliation discipline. Executives need confidence in dashboards and drill-down logic. Organizational change management should address process ownership, policy updates, communication cadence, and local champions. Adoption improves when leaders explain why controls are changing, how automation reduces low-value work, and what metrics will define success after go-live.
- Run conference room pilots early to validate future-state process design before full build completion.
- Use cutover rehearsals to test migration timing, opening balances, approval activation, and reporting readiness.
- Define hypercare support with named owners, issue severity rules, daily triage, and executive escalation paths.
- Track adoption through operational indicators such as invoice cycle time, approval turnaround, unmatched bills, and report preparation effort.
How should executives govern ROI, risk, and long-term modernization?
Executive governance should be active throughout the program, not limited to steering committee updates. Leaders should review scope control, design decisions, risk exposure, testing evidence, and readiness criteria at each stage gate. Project governance is strongest when finance, procurement, IT, and business operations share accountability for outcomes. Risk management should cover integration failure, poor data quality, uncontrolled customization, weak adoption, compliance gaps, and cutover disruption. Business continuity planning should include rollback criteria, manual fallback procedures for critical billing and payment activities, and support coverage during close periods.
Business ROI should be measured through operational and control improvements, not just license consolidation. Typical value drivers include faster invoice issuance, reduced procurement cycle time, fewer manual reconciliations, improved spend visibility, stronger policy compliance, and more reliable management reporting. AI-assisted implementation opportunities are emerging in requirements summarization, test case generation, document classification, anomaly detection, and workflow automation design. These should be used to accelerate delivery and improve quality, but always under human governance, especially where financial controls or compliance decisions are involved.
Future trends point toward more event-driven integrations, embedded analytics, policy-aware automation, and tighter linkage between ERP transactions and executive decision support. For enterprises adopting Odoo, the strategic advantage will come from disciplined standardization combined with selective extensibility. The organizations that benefit most are not those that customize the most, but those that govern process design, data quality, and operating accountability the best.
